Fantastic location but otherwise a very average experience given the price. A hotel room in the basement, which you walk down some dingy stairs and the public toilets to get to was not my idea of a boutique hotel experience. Also the public areas and carpets had a stale beer smell like you get in a bar. The bathroom was also very small and awkward with the door opening into the small space. The bedroom was otherwise a good size but dark given we were in the basement. I was also shocked that they expect you to pay for parking given the cost of the room.

Very disappointing as hotel received good reviews on Trip Advisor so I expected my stay to be much better. The old part of the hotel is very worn and tired and in need of a revamp. The carpet going up the stairs to the rooms was very dirty and stained - not a good first impression on arrival. The smell of food from the kitchen was very obvious in the bar area and carried up the stairs to the rooms. The TV reception was very poor. The reason given was the weather but even with good weather the reception was very intermittent.
